3.3 V Zero Delay Clock Buffer NB2304A The NB2304A is a versatile, 3.3 V zero delay buffer designed to distribute highspeed clocks in PC, workstation, datacom, telecom and other highperformance applications. It is available in an 8 pin www.onsemi.com package. The part has an onchip PLL which locks to an input clock presented on the REF pin. The PLL feedback is required to be driven to FBK pin, and can be obtained from one of the outputs. The inputtooutput propagation delay is guaranteed to be less than 8 250 ps, and the output tooutput skew is guaranteed to be less than 1 200 ps. SOIC8 The NB2304A has two Banks of two outputs each. Multiple D SUFFIX NB2304A devices can accept the same input clock and distribute it. In CASE 751 this case, the skew between the outputs of the two devices is guaranteed to be less than 500 ps. The NB2304A is available in two different configurations (Refer to MARKING DIAGRAM NB2304A Configurations Table). The NB2304AI1 is the base part, 8 where the output frequencies equal the reference if there is no counter 4lx in the feedback path. The NB2304AI2 allows the user to obtain REF, ALYW 1/2 X and 2X frequencies on each output Bank.
